SGLGW
Coreless GW linear servo motors are composed of moving coils and
stationary magnet tracks. The moving coil has no iron content and is
made of accurately resin molded motor windings. The stationary
magnet track is made of two nickelized steel plates with accurately
placed rare-earth magnets on each side. The steel plates are jointed at
one end to form a U-channel to provide space for the moving coils.
SGLFW
Iron core FW linear motors are composed of moving coils with laminated
iron-core and single sided stationary magnet tracks. The moving coil of the
FW linear motor is composed of laminated iron core and prewound coil
bobbins inserted into the slots located on the laminated iron cores. The
entire coil unit is permanently encapsulated in a thermally conductive resin
body to give structural rigidity. The magnet track of the FW is made of a row
of rare earth magnets accurately placed on one side of the nickelized steel
carrier plate. Stainless steel magnet covers guard against minor accidental
damage to the magnets.
SGLTW
Iron core TW linear motors are composed of moving coils with a laminated
iron-core and a pair of stationary magnet tracks that are placed on each
side of the moving coils. The moving coil of the TW linear motor is
composed of laminated iron core and prewound coil bobbins inserted into
the slots located on the laminated iron cores. The entire coil unit is
permanently encapsulated in a thermally conductive resin body to give
structural rigidity. The magnet track of the TW is made of a row of rare
earth magnets accurately placed on one side of the nickelized steel carrier
plate. Two of the magnet carrier plates are used as a pair in a fashion
similar to that of the coreless type linear motor. Stainless steel magnet
covers guard against minor accidental damage to the magnets.
Sigma Trac SGT
The Sigma Trac SGT is a series of linear actuators designed to reduce the
work and unknown costs often involved in implementing linear motor
technology into automation machines. Factory assembled to a precision
aluminum base, Sigma Trac SGT delivers uncompromising linear motor
performance in a bolt-on, plug-in package. Automatic motor recognition
means start-up of the Sigma Trac is as quick and easy as a rotary servo
system. Sigma Trac is well suited for single-axis point-to-point applications
or for use in coordinated motion applications, faster cycle times are the
common result. Speeds up to 5 m/s and acceleration up to 5 g are possible.
